Dabaru enjoys smooth travel access through the Mandasa APSRTC Bus Station supported by Palasa routes.
Dabaru Village relies on Mandasa Railway Station and Palasa Railway Station for regular rail connectivity.
Residents of Dabaru Village rely on Visakhapatnam Airport and Biju Patnaik Airport in Bhubaneswar for their air connectivity.
